p300 KAT regulates SOX10 stability and function in human melanoma
2024-02-23
Abstract excerpt
SOX10 is a lineage-specific transcription factor critical for melanoma tumor growth, while SOX10 loss-of-function drives the emergence of therapy-resistant, invasive melanoma phenotypes. A major challenge has been developing therapeutic strategies targeting SOX10’s role in melanoma proliferation, while preventing a concomitant increase in tumor cell invasion.
